diff options
author | Mark Eichin <eichin@mit.edu> | 1994-10-01 00:06:35 +0000 |
---|---|---|
committer | Mark Eichin <eichin@mit.edu> | 1994-10-01 00:06:35 +0000 |
commit | 01c80babf876a76305183fce0a4a09f9537040eb (patch) | |
tree | f0442b65d2e7e905ad6b0c03cab0c29deb0935c6 /src/util/kbuild | |
parent | b5b0b8606467cba4f204bd05786d575492db5a0c (diff) | |
download | krb5-01c80babf876a76305183fce0a4a09f9537040eb.zip krb5-01c80babf876a76305183fce0a4a09f9537040eb.tar.gz krb5-01c80babf876a76305183fce0a4a09f9537040eb.tar.bz2 |
* kbuild: set SRCDIR by default from program name
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@4415 dc483132-0cff-0310-8789-dd5450dbe970
Diffstat (limited to 'src/util/kbuild')
-rw-r--r-- | src/util/kbuild | 12 |
1 files changed, 12 insertions, 0 deletions
diff --git a/src/util/kbuild b/src/util/kbuild index 621c1e1..a2496c2 100644 --- a/src/util/kbuild +++ b/src/util/kbuild @@ -33,6 +33,18 @@ progname=$0 pts="`echo ${progname} | sed 's=[^/]*$=='`" +# +# sneak in default knowledge that this program is one level down from the +# top of the source tree +# + +case $pts in +/*) SRCDIR="`echo ${pts} | sed 's=[^/]*/*$=='`" + echo "default srcdir $SRCDIR";; +../*) SRCDIR="`cd ${pts}/.. ; pwd`" + echo "default srcdir $SRCDIR";; +esac + conflib=". $pts/kfrags" THISCONF=./kbuild.temp |